François Vernay (French, 1821-1896), Autumnal Landscape, signed "F Vernay" on each side, oil and pencil on paper, double-sided, 21 x 31.50 cm. Known primarily for his still-life paintings, François Vernay also distinguished himself as a landscape artist. Little known during his lifetime, he is now considered as one of the most important representatives of the Lyon School.

Double sided oil paintings on a thin piece of board or card. There are undulations across the card. The paint layers have been thinly applied with the card support visible as a mid-tone in the compositions. The artist has marked out the composition in pencil before painting. The paint layers are in a good condition overall. Both sides of the frame are glazed.
